The fundamental components of ammo are the same for rifle, gun, and shotgun ammo. Recognizing exactly how ammunition works is an important facet in being a responsible gun owner. Today we're taking a look at the what the standard components of ammo are and how they function together to discharge a round. The fundamental components of ammunition revealed on a 9mm. Ammunition for Sale round.The bullet is seated in the open end of the case. When you terminate a bullet out of a semi-auto weapon, the gun's extractor lifts the instance from the firing chamber and it flies out of the weapon.
A gun's shooting pin strikes a cartridge's guide. The guide is situated in the edge of the situation of a rimfire cartridge.

Both typical types of primers in centerfire cartridges are Berdan and Boxer primers. Gunpowder beside the instance that generally includes it. Powder, additionally referred to as propellant or gunpowder, is a fast-burning chemical mixture. The guide surge sparks it. It is normally a combination of saltpeter, charcoal, and sulfur.

We call the projectiles for shotshells, which we terminate via shotguns, slugs and shot. A slug is one solid item, usually constructed out of lead. Shot is a group of pellets constructed out of lead, steel, bismuth, or tungsten alloy. Shot pellets can be available in various dimensions and amounts. Since you have a fundamental understanding of the fundamental components of ammunition, you can really feel a little bit extra certain in how your weapon and ammo function!.

Fun truth: Grains are used to describe the mass of a bullet because all the means back in the very early days of weapons, it was a dispenser's unit of dimension, and a common denominator was needed to identify just how much bring about use to make cast lead bullets (Buy Ammo Online). 'Grains' as an unit of procedure for weight goes all the method back to ancient times, and represents the weight of a grain of wheat

(https://trello.com/w/ammunitiondde/members)For recommendation, the weight of a paper clip is around 16 gr. We recognize that grains are a step of mass, and a lot more = heavier, and heavy is great? Yes, heavy is excellent, but mass of the projectile isn't the only thing you need to consider when selecting a round for your weapon.

This spin is produced by grooves reduced or inculcated the inside of the barrel, which are described as 'rifling'. Enjoyable truth, this is the origin of the term "Rifle" ex lover. A rifled firearm vs. smoothbore musket. The result this spin carries projectiles is a supporting one the bullet turning maintains the nose directed straight, similarly that a flawlessly spiraled football throw is mosting likely to be much a lot more steady and precise in flight than an awful duck, end over end toss.
Just how does this associate with grain weight? Envision you're on among those playground carousels, the ones with bars you hang on to while it rotates. Or a circus experience where you're strapped to a board, encountering inwards, which revolves truly fast. When it's spinning gradually, you do not feel much, and it's easy to hold on.
The very same impact happens with bullets. The larger the projectile, the even more impact a faster rotate will certainly have on it.

But there's an additional factor that we need to think about when picking a grain weight for our ammunition. As hinted at above, bullet rate, or the speed of the projectile, is a major aspect when figuring out the most effective grain weight projectile to utilize. Speed is affected by a few major aspects, consisting of the type and amount of propellant (gunpowder), barrel length, and bullet weight.

The most common grain weight rounds for 9x19mm cartridges are 115gr and 124gr. These are generally lead core, completely jacketed (FMJ) rounds. Both of these grain weight cartridges will execute well in factory 9mm handguns, to typical pistol ranges (as much as 50 lawns). 115 grain rounds are the most common (and as a result least costly).
